Visitors to the Kestrel prototype workshop at Dunmore Works must be pre-registered and accompanied at all times. Reception should issue a red lanyard, confirm photo ID, and log entry and exit times. Photography is not permitted inside the workshop. If the escorting engineer is delayed, visitors wait in the atrium. The workshop door code for escorts is below.

staff pass of kahop-kadup = bdg-NCCCQ-99141

# Onboarding: Autocomplete Index (Querrel Search)

Welcome aboard. One known pain point you'll hear about immediately: the autocomplete index on Querrel rebuilds nightly and has been slow since the Velmora dataset doubled. Rebuilds now take roughly four hours, and partial updates sometimes lag behind writes by twenty minutes. Mirella's team owns the indexer; coordinate with them before touching shard configs. To push index artifacts to the staging cluster, you will need the deploy credential, which is provided directly below.

rollout seal: bky4_x7Gc

## Deployment — Sievecap

Sievecap sits in front of the Pebblestore key-value service and filters definitely-missing keys with a bloom filter, saving us a ton of pointless lookups. Reviewer notes: the filter rebuilds on a timer, not on writes, so expect brief false-negative-free-but-stale windows after bulk loads. Deploy is a plain container rollout; the filter warms from a snapshot in about a minute. Sizing math lives in docs/sizing.md if you want to check it. The knobs it boots with are below.

service settings:
feneth:
  pin: 7099
  tenant: aldvan
  seal: seal_b296c631
  metrics_host: metrics.feneth.novactech.internal
  standby_team: tamax
  escalation: gorael-casok
  nonce: a02f99

Minutes — Management Meeting on Calderis Line Pricing

Attendees: R. Venn, L. Okafor-Hale, T. Brissard. The committee reviewed margin analysis for the Calderis instrument line. Agreed: list prices rise 4% next quarter; volume discounts capped at 12%; the entry-tier Calderis Mini holds current pricing to protect share against Wrenlow Instruments. Sales leads to update quote templates within ten days. A confidential pricing contingency was agreed and is recorded below.

internal memo for hahif-hahaf: Headcount on the Zorwyn team goes from 9 to 100 by the end of October. Gross margin on Zorwyn came in at 5 percent against a plan of 10 percent.